The Smurfs battle Gargamel in world levels in this Infogrames Mega Drive platformer. Published by Infogrames, released in Europe in 1996. Platformer with the blue Smurfs exploring varied world levels, Gargamel enemies and comic strip humour.

The line of the Belgian comic is respected to the letter: round silhouettes in white caps, clean outlines, flats of plain blue. The levels tour the globe and each takes on the colours of its region, ice floe, savannah, jungle, oriental city, producing a succession of very readable tableaux.

Collector interest

Les Schtroumpfs Autour du Monde PAL is the European edition of the Infogrames game adapted from the Peyo comic, distributed by Infogrames on Megadrive with French localization. Its collector value comes from the French-language specificity of the Smurfs license and from the fact that the Megadrive version remains one of the rare official console adaptations of this Belgian franchise.
